目的观察结缔组织生长因子(CTGF)反义寡核苷酸对TGF-β1诱导的肾小管上皮细胞NRK52E胶原Ⅲ分泌的影响。方法采用脂质体介导的方法将CTGF反义寡核苷酸导入细胞,转化生长因子β1(TGF-β1)刺激48 h后,用RT-PCR、ELISA法观察CTGF和胶原Ⅲ的表达。结果TGF-β1能够诱导NRK52E细胞表达CTGF并进而促进胶原Ⅲ的分泌,CTGF反义寡核苷酸导入细胞后可以大部分取消TGF-β1的作用,而对照组的寡核苷酸没有此作用。结论CTGF反义寡核苷酸能够特异地抑制CTGF的表达,进而阻止细胞外基质的生成,这可能是治疗肾间质纤维化的一条新途径。
Objective To observe the effects of connective tissue growth factor (CTGF) antisense oligonucleotide on the secretion of collagen Ⅲ of NRK52E induced by TGF-β1 in renal tubular epithelial cells. Methods CTGF antisense oligonucleotides were introduced into cells by liposome-mediated method. The expression of CTGF and collagen Ⅲ was detected by RT-PCR and ELISA after stimulated by transforming growth factor-β1 (TGF-β1) for 48 h. Results TGF-β1 induced the expression of CTGF in NRK52E cells and promoted the secretion of collagen Ⅲ. However, most of the effects of TGF-β1 were abolished after CTGF antisense oligonucleotides were introduced into the cells, while the control oligonucleotides did not. Conclusion CTGF antisense oligonucleotide can specifically inhibit the expression of CTGF, thereby preventing the extracellular matrix formation, which may be a new way to treat renal interstitial fibrosis.
